Elaine Pagels is a historian of religion and a professor at Princeton University. She is the author of many books including The Gnostic Gospels, Beyond Belief: The Secret Gospel of Thomas, and Why Religion? A Personal Story. In 2016 she was awarded the National Medal for the Arts from then US President Barack Obama. She is a leading expert on the Gnostic Gospels and early Christianity.
